Output e623b5d9a4e9978036a3c549fd258b2893e9c11b49ff55eeeffc3e187ded316c:2

value
578265
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2b1507ac5c8f40dc00f8caf231c9f9271f57f316 OP_EQUALVERIFY OP_CHECKSIG
address
14voFSLjvpuPuNTLU7XNjERu1uKSXv8jJY
transaction
e623b5d9a4e9978036a3c549fd258b2893e9c11b49ff55eeeffc3e187ded316c
spent
true